America’s Houses of Worship
• If 370,000 congregations cut energy use by 20%…
– Save nearly $630 million• for ministry, missions, priorities
– Cut electricity use by 3.6 billion kWh– Prevent more than 2.6 million tons of
greenhouse gas emissions• Equivalent to the emissions of about 480,000 cars• Equivalent to planting nearly 600,000 trees
• But, on average 30% of energy use in buildings is wasted

4
• Management Tool – Provides organizations a platform to:– Assess whole building energy and water consumption– Track changes in energy, water, greenhouse gas emissions, and cost over time– Track green power purchases– Share/report data with others– Create custom reports– Apply for ENERGY STAR certification with professional data verification
• Metrics Calculator – Provides key performance metrics– Energy consumption (source, site, weather normalized)– Water consumption (indoor, outdoor)– Greenhouse gas emissions (indirect, direct, total, avoided)– ENERGY STAR 1-to-100 score (available for 15 building types)
• Does not replace consultant or members’ “time and talent”… – Needed to analyze and assist with audits and upgrades
Accessible in a free, online platform: www.energystar.gov/benchmark

• The standard national platform for benchmarking energy use in U.S. commercial buildings
• Adopted by leading commercial real estate, retail, healthcare, and educational organizations– Including Building Owners and Managers Association and American
Society for Healthcare Engineering; incorporated by U.S. Green Building Council for Leadership in Energy and Environmental Design (LEED)
• Adopted by state and local governments for mandatory reporting under their benchmarking laws– New York City, California, DC, Seattle, Washington State, San
Francisco, etc.
• Required for buildings owned and occupied by U.S. Federal Agencies
• Selected by the Canadian Government as national energy management platform for existing commercial and institutional buildings

Benchmarking in Portfolio Manager Continues to Increase
• As of the end of 2011, 260,000 buildings benchmarked– About 40% of U.S. commercial
space
• Tens of thousands of active accounts– 3,500 logins each day
• As of the end of 2011, nearly 16,500 buildings achieved ENERGY STAR certification

ENERGY STAR Certified Buildings
• Grown exponentially in past decade– 30% last year alone
• Annual Savings compared to average
– $2.3 billion in utility bills
– 12 million metric tons of CO2e
• Use 35% less energy and are responsible for 35% less GHG emissions
• Other advantages:– Lower operational cost
– Increased asset value
– Higher occupancy rates
– Lower risk premiums
